Vasiliki Karioti is an Assistant Professor at the Department of Tourism Management at the University of Patras. She was born in 1973 in Patras and graduated from the University of Patras in 1996 with a degree in Mathematics, specializing in Statistical Theory of Probability and Operational Research. She then obtained an M.Sc. in Statistical Analysis and Stochastic Systems from the University of Manchester (UMIST) in 1997. In 2003, she completed her doctoral dissertation at the National Technical University of Athens, titled "The Development of Statistical Methods in Time Series Models for the Detection of Outliers or Sequences."
From 2005 to 2019, she served as an Assistant Professor at the Department of Accounting and Finance at the Technological Educational Institute of Western Greece. Her research interests include time series analysis, econometrics, neural networks, robust statistics, and medical statistics. She has published papers in international journals and actively participates in scientific conferences.
